
AI Governance, Legal Counsel
Posted Aug 4

Posted Aug 4
This is a fully remote position, open to applicants in United Kingdom.
• Lead the AI and data governance workstream for customer implementations.
• Determine customer needs for internal approval, coordinate inputs from Spotted Zebra, and ensure governance processes progress smoothly.
• Assist with pre-sales and post-sales inquiries from customers regarding AI governance, human oversight, automated decision-making, fairness, explainability, bias, data protection, privacy, and regulatory compliance.
• Develop, maintain, and customize customer-facing governance documentation, which includes AI governance packs, DPIA materials, risk assessments, model and product documentation, explanations of human oversight, bias-audit evidence, candidate notices, FAQs, and due diligence responses.
• Monitor legislation and regulatory requirements across various operating regions and maintain a jurisdiction-by-obligation matrix.
• Support governance related to data protection, privacy, and automated decision-making.
• Coordinate both external and internal assurance efforts, including independent bias audits.
• Maintain DPIAs, risk assessments, provider documentation, technical files, model cards, risk registers, and evidence for the maturity of the AI management system and ISO/IEC 42001 readiness.
• Convert governance requirements into product and process enhancements that involve consent capture, candidate notifications, human review, retention, contestability, audit trails, reporting, and customer configurations.
• Create templates, playbooks, standard responses, implementation checklists, and governance workflows.
• Serve as the primary in-house legal counsel by reviewing and negotiating customer and supplier agreements, providing advice on contractual risks and daily legal issues, and involving external specialist counsel as necessary.
